Singer Noble held in women torture case: DMP

Greenwatch Desk Crime 2025-05-20, 1:04pm

images55-b7ea1f784749d3a85697aa05f08733b01747731360.jpg




Police on Tuesday detained popular singer Mainul Ahsan Noble from Demra area of Dhaka in a case over women torture.


Md Talebur Rahman, deputy commissioner (media and public relations) of Dhaka Metropolitan Police (DMP), said a team of Demra police station held him in the morning, reports UNB.

Details about the arrest are still awaited, he added.
